Mallika is a writer, commentator/presenter and board adviser/non executive director in food, drink and hospitality. She is the published author of two cookbooks (Miss Masala: Real Indian Cooking for Busy Living and Masala: Indian Cooking for Modern Living). Mallika writes an award-nominated newsletter More than Curry covering the link between food, people and planet, as well as recipes and stories on food and culture in other publications.

Mallika has over two decades of expeprience in board-level communications and strategic advisory. During the pandemic, she developed proprietary thinking for organisations and changemakers on navigating major cultural shifts, cultural sensitivity and establishing strong foundations in diversity, equity and inclusion thinking.

Her clients have included Sustainable Restaurant Association, Jamie Oliver Group and Waitrose. She supported the sensitive and respectful development of a new range of Cooks’ Ingredients at Waitrose and wrote Borough Market’s 2030 strategy. Mallika is a finale judge for the Guild of Fine Food’s Great Taste Awards, co-presents the awards ceremony and judges the ethical and sustainable category bursary annually.

Mallika was born in India, and moved to England for her undergraduate and masters degrees in Business Studies and Journalism. When not talking, writing or cooking, Mallika can be found diverting her teenage children away from UPFs in South London.
